Openspace invests in Indonesian eyewear brand SATURDAYS and Malaysia’s ServAuto

February 20, 2026
Image from Openspace Capital

New $$$ incoming. Singapore’s Openspace Capital announced their investments in Indonesian eyewear brand SATURDAYS and Malaysia-based car care platform ServAuto

About Openspace. Openspace Capital is a multi-strategy asset manager focused on SEA.

  • They invest in tech-native and tech-enabled businesses across multiple stages. 

👓 Glasses, anyone? 

Indonesian D2C lifestyle eyewear brand SATURDAYS was reported to have raised $6.3M earlier this January from Openspace, DSG Consumer Partners, and Altara Ventures.

  • SATURDAYS designs high-quality frames in-house and sells them at affordable prices.
  • The brand offers an omnichannel experience through its app, home try-on service, and physical stores, where customers can enjoy drinks and snacks. 

The wow factor. According to Openspace, the brand has several expansion opportunities within and beyond Indonesia. They also observed clear repeat-purchase behaviour.

🚗 Here to serve you

Malaysia-based ServAuto also raised an undisclosed amount of funding earlier this month. 

Vynn Capital led the round, with Jelawang Capital, Openspace, SWC Global, Gobi Partners, and strategic angel investors also participating.

  • ServAuto connects users to authorized workshops with transparent pricing and high-quality service.
  • The platform solves Malaysia’s fragmented automotive aftersales market by bringing greater transparency and consistent service to consumers.
